Mehi Dabbagh in San Jose, CA

Mehi Dabbagh may also have lived outside of San Jose, such as Santa Cruz and Sunnyvale.

Refine Your Search Results
All Filters
2

Mehdi A Dabbagh

Resides in San Jose, CA
Lived InSanta Cruz CA, Sunnyvale CA, Punta Gorda FL
Related To
Also known asMehi Dabbagh, Mehdi Dabagh
IncludesAddress(6) Phone(1)
See Results